Time-domain modelling of power transformers using modal analysis

The paper describes how a new form of transformer model, based on modal transformer analysis, may be converted from the frequency domain into the time domain for EMTP implementation. Given results confirm that the resulting time-domain model is able to accurately account for the frequency-dependent effects of practical transformers. The novelty of the model is that it is centred on natural modes of oscillation. These are accessed by linear transformations leading to a highly efficient structure from a computational viewpoint.
